Comprehending Window Damage

Before diving into the specifics of professional window repair, it is important to understand the different types of window damage that property owners might come across. Below is a table describing some typical kinds of window damage:

Type of DamageDescriptionPossible Causes
Split GlassNoticeable fractures in the glass panesEffect damage, temperature level modifications
Broken SealFailure of the spacer in between glass panes, causing foggingAge, humidity, thermal growth
Loose FramesFrames that have become separated or warpedImproper installation, aging
Damaged HardwareBroken or malfunctioning window locks, hinges, or deals withWear and tear, rust
Leaking WindowsWater seepage through fractures or gapsPoor installation, weather condition damage

What to Expect During the Repair Process

When employing specialists for window repair, house owners can expect a systematic technique. Here's a summary of the normal actions included:

  1. Initial Inspection: Professionals will examine the windows to assess the type and extent of damage before suggesting a repair strategy.
  2. Expense Estimate: After evaluating the damage, the company will supply a comprehensive estimate describing the expenses included, including products and labor.
  3. Repair Scheduling: Once an expense contract is reached, a practical time for the repair work will be scheduled.
  4. Repair Process: On the day of repair, professionals will arrive with the necessary tools and products. They will prepare the area, get rid of any broken components, and perform the repair or replacement as required.
  5. Final Inspection: After repairs are finished, a last assessment will ensure that everything is operating correctly and satisfies security requirements.
  6. Follow-Up: Many credible window repair services will follow up after the repair to make sure client fulfillment and deal with any staying issues.

Frequently Asked Questions about Professional Window Repair

1. How do I understand if my windows require repair?

Signs that your windows might require repair include cracks in the glass, drafts, condensation between panes, trouble opening or closing, or visible frame damage.

2. Can I repair my windows myself?

While small repairs may be possible for some property owners, it is typically best to look for professional help to guarantee security and quality repair.

4. For how long does window repair take?

A lot of minor repairs can be finished within a few hours, while more extensive repairs may take a day or more.

5. Will my windows be covered under service warranty?

This depends on the window maker. Evaluation your guarantee contract to check if window repairs are consisted of.

6. How can I maintain my windows to avoid damage?

Regular maintenance, such as cleansing and examining for signs of wear, can help extend the life of your windows. Think about resealing them every couple of years.
